An American actor born on November 26, 1939, he gained prominence for his character roles in film and television. Known for his collaborations with director Darren Aronofsky, he appeared in films like "Pi," "Requiem for a Dream," and "The Fountain." He earned widespread recognition for his portrayal of Hector Salamanca in the acclaimed TV series "Breaking Bad" and its prequel "Better Call Saul." His career spanned over five decades, showcasing his versatility and intense on-screen presence.
